Boot Windows 10 from USB Flash Drive: The Ultimate Step-by-Step Guide

Booting Windows 10 from a USB flash drive is a fundamental skill for any power user or IT professional, serving as the cornerstone for system recovery, clean installations, and advanced troubleshooting. This process leverages the Universal Serial Bus (USB) port to override the default boot sequence, directing the computer to load a portable operating system environment stored on a flash drive rather than the internal hard drive. By doing so, users gain access to the full feature set of Windows 10 without touching the existing installation, making it an invaluable technique for refreshing a sluggish system or setting up multiple machines with consistent configurations.

Why Boot from USB: The Strategic Advantages

The primary motivation for booting from a USB flash drive is the creation of a safe, isolated sandbox for system-level operations. When the internal Windows installation is corrupted, unresponsive, or infected with malware that prevents a standard login, a bootable USB acts as a digital lifeboat. It allows technicians to bypass the compromised operating system entirely, gaining full administrative control to delete malicious files, repair system registries, or reset user credentials. Furthermore, this method is significantly faster than relying on built-in recovery partitions, which are often bloated with manufacturer-specific bloatware and recovery data.

Hardware and Software Prerequisites

Before initiating the process, ensuring compatibility between the hardware firmware and the software tools is critical. Modern systems utilize Unified Extensible Firmware Interface (UEFI), while older machines rely on Basic Input/Output System (BIOS), dictating the required partition style of the USB drive. A drive formatted in GUID Partition Table (GPT) is necessary for UEFI systems to boot securely, whereas BIOS-based machines require a Master Boot Record (MBR) partition. Additionally, the USB flash drive must have sufficient capacity—typically 16GB or more—to accommodate the Windows 10 media creation tool files, and the target machine must be configured to recognize USB drives as valid boot devices in the firmware settings.

Microsoft provides an official and streamlined solution through the Media Creation Tool, which simplifies the complexity of manual ISO downloads and formatting. This utility handles the intricate tasks of downloading the correct Windows 10 edition, partitioning the drive according to the system’s firmware, and ensuring the boot files are correctly structured. The process involves downloading the tool from the official Microsoft website, accepting the license terms, and selecting the "Create installation media" option. Users must then specify the language, architecture (32-bit or 64-bit), and destination drive, allowing the application to verify the USB flash drive’s integrity before writing the necessary files.

Troubleshooting Media Creation

Even with the official tool, users may encounter roadblocks such as USB security features or insufficient disk space. Some flash drives come with write-protect switches or contain proprietary security software that can interfere with the formatting process, requiring physical switches to be toggled or third-party utilities to remove the write protection. If the Media Creation Tool fails to recognize the drive, formatting the USB flash drive manually to NTFS or FAT32 using Diskpart commands can resolve the issue. It is also essential to verify the integrity of the downloaded ISO file using checksum validation to ensure the file was not corrupted during the download process.

Configuring the BIOS/UEFI Boot Order

With the physical media prepared, the computer must be coaxed into prioritizing the USB port over the internal storage during the startup sequence. This requires accessing the firmware settings menu, usually by pressing a specific key like F2, Delete, or Esc during the initial power-on screen. Within the BIOS or UEFI interface, the Boot tab houses the boot priority menu, where the USB flash drive must be moved to the top of the list. For systems with Fast Boot enabled, this feature might prevent the access menu from appearing, necessitating a temporary disablement of Fast Boot to reach the boot device options.
